I think there's a misplaced focus on "first" experiences being optimal in some way.

Whether a kid is going to take to programming or not is pretty unlikely to change based on whether they're introduced to a block-based or text-based language, or whether it's object oriented or functional (the push for objects-first has mostly died off, but I still see remnants of it in various curricula).

If it's got a few basics like conditionals, iteration, structured grammar, etc. it will be plenty to give students the flavor of what programming is about.

The better criteria, in my mind, are "does it allow you to make/do something interesting?" and "how easily does it lead into the next level of learning?".

I can say it has for me. I spent a couple years on scratch as a kid before moving on to other languages, and it helped me really get into programming.

My hobby projects are almost always video games to this day, partially because of it. I even built my first compiler/interpreter on there before I knew what those words meant, and got exposed to lots of math that I otherwise wouldn't have seen until high school. Being able to easily discover what others were doing, and learn from their projects, helped me out a lot.

It will always be special to me, as I'm sure BASIC and such are to others.
